The Type 073 is a family of Chinese medium landing ships in service with the People's Liberation Army Navy.

One Type 073III (NATO reporting name: Yudeng) was built. [4] [6] It was decommissioned in 2010. It was later converted and used as a supply ship for the South China Sea with two deck hatches and a crane. [6]

The Type 073A (NATO reporting name: Yunshu) [6] (also called Type 074IV) is based on the Type 073III. [5]
